Holding

The Tribunal declares that the Claimant and other members of Gateway House Investment are the rightful owners of the plot LR No Nairobi 209/2571.

Facts

The Claimant was a member of the Respondent's Sacco who resigned and withdrew his membership. The Respondent failed to refund his shares within 60 days, leading to a decree in favor of the Claimant.

Issues

  1. Refund of shares
  2. Sale of plot LR No Nairobi 209/2571
  3. Ownership of plot LR No Nairobi 209/2571

Reasoning

The Tribunal considered the well-established procedures for resolving disputes and the hierarchy of courts. The Claimant's request for a permanent injunction was dismissed as the matter was already before the High Court.

Outcome

The Tribunal allowed the application and declared the Claimant and other members of Gateway House Investment as the rightful owners of the plot LR No Nairobi 209/2571.

Orders

  • A declaration that the Claimant and other members of Gateway House Investment are the rightful owners of the plot LR No Nairobi 209/2571.
